The future of Sittingbourne will be at the top of the agenda when the town’s Local Engagement Forum meets tonight (Thursday).

Swale council’s regeneration director, Pete Raine, will give an update on the Sittingbourne town centre development proposals and property consultants Essential Land will talk about progress on the Sittingbourne Mill and wharf site.

The Milton Creek Gateway will also be under discussion.

The public are invited to raise issues with councillors, the police, fire brigade and other organisations from 6.30pm.

The meeting will be held at Borden Grammar School, Avenue of Remembrance, Sittingbourne.
